Nairobi National Park day Tour

Nairobi National Park is one of Kenya's most remarkable wildlife destinations and holds the distinction of being the country's oldest national park. Established in 1946, the park is uniquely situated just a few kilometers from Nairobi's city center, making it the only national park in the world located so close to a capital city. Covering approximately 117 square kilometers, the park offers visitors a rare opportunity to enjoy an authentic African safari experience while viewing wildlife against the backdrop of Nairobi's modern skyline.

The park is characterized by diverse habitats that include open grass plains, scattered acacia bushland, riverine forests, rocky valleys, and seasonal wetlands. These varied ecosystems support an impressive range of wildlife species, making the park a haven for nature lovers, photographers, birdwatchers, and safari enthusiasts. Despite its proximity to the city, Nairobi National Park provides a genuine wilderness experience where animals roam freely in their natural environment.

Visitors can expect to encounter a wide variety of wildlife during their game drives. Commonly sighted animals include lions, giraffes, zebras, buffaloes, wildebeests, impalas, gazelles, elands, hartebeests, warthogs, and hyenas. The park is particularly renowned for its successful conservation of the endangered black rhinoceros, offering one of the best opportunities in Kenya to see these magnificent animals in the wild. Predators such as cheetahs and leopards also inhabit the park, although sightings are less frequent and often depend on timing, weather conditions, and a bit of luck.

A typical safari in Nairobi National Park involves a guided game drive along a network of well-maintained tracks that traverse the park's diverse landscapes. Early morning game drives are especially rewarding, as wildlife is generally more active during the cooler hours of the day. Visitors may witness lions returning from a night hunt, giraffes browsing on acacia trees, or rhinos grazing peacefully in the open plains. Afternoon drives also provide excellent wildlife viewing opportunities and beautiful lighting for photography.

The park is home to over 400 bird species, making it a paradise for birdwatchers. Species such as ostriches, secretary birds, crowned cranes, eagles, vultures, and numerous migratory birds can often be observed throughout the year.

In addition to game viewing, visitors can enhance their experience by exploring nearby attractions such as the Nairobi Safari Walk, which offers elevated walkways and educational exhibits, and the David Sheldrick Wildlife Trust, famous for rescuing and rehabilitating orphaned elephants.

Nairobi National Park full-day excursion offers a perfect combination of wildlife viewing, conservation experiences, and cultural discovery. The tour is carefully planned to ensure visitors enjoy Nairobi's top attractions comfortably within a single day.

6:00 AM – 6:30 AM Pickup from your hotel, residence, or the airport and departure for Nairobi National Park.

6:30 AM – 10:30 AM Enjoy a guided morning game drive in Nairobi National Park. Explore the park's diverse landscapes while searching for wildlife such as lions, rhinos, giraffes, zebras, buffaloes, wildebeests, antelopes, and numerous bird species.

10:30 AM – 11:00 AM Transfer to the Elephant Orphanage.

11:00 AM – 12:00 PM Visit the Elephant Orphanage and learn about the rescue, rehabilitation, and conservation of orphaned elephants. Observe the young elephants during their feeding session and gain insight into ongoing wildlife conservation efforts.

12:15 PM – 1:15 PM Visit the Giraffe Centre and enjoy an opportunity to observe and feed the endangered Rothschild's giraffes from an elevated viewing platform while learning about giraffe conservation initiatives

.1:15 PM – 2:15 PM Lunch at a local restaurant.

2:30 PM – 3:30 PM Visit the Kazuri Beads Factory for a guided tour of the workshop. Learn about the production of handcrafted ceramic beads and pottery while supporting a community-based enterprise that provides employment opportunities for local artisans.

3:30 PM – 4:00 PM Time for relaxation, souvenir shopping, or refreshments.

4:00 PM – 5:00 PM Transfer back to your hotel, residence, or the airport.

Tour Duration: Approximately 10–11 hours
